This alert fires when backend instances report healthy to the Marrowgate balancer but fail the deeper application-level probe, indicating a possible bypass of authentication middleware or a degraded TLS termination path. Treat divergence lasting more than five minutes as a potential security event, since traffic may be routed to partially initialized nodes. Capture the probe logs before draining any instance. The verification checklist and containment procedure are documented on the internal page.

dashboard of tajof-kaweg = https://confluence.tolvaqlabs.internal/display/projects/display/display

The Haulwick fleet fuel-usage report runs nightly under the svc-fuelmetrics account. It pulls odometer and pump data from the Drayline ingest API, aggregates per vehicle, and writes to the reporting bucket. If rotating the account, update the scheduler config first. The ingest API key currently in use is listed below.

service key, bajog-yahop: kto7_mMHVCpJ

### Step 4: Extract translation strings

Run the `lingograb` script from the repo root to pull all translatable strings out of the legacy Pellwood templates. It writes JSON catalogs into `locales/`. The script talks to the Tornquist translation service, so it needs credentials and endpoint settings in place first. Set the following configuration values before running it.

service settings:
[casax]
port = 6379
team = rusir
host = casax.zemvarhq.corp
region = outer-4
access_code = ac_9808ce
timeout_ms = 1500

The debounce was raised in release 4.2 after the Quillbrook suggestion service showed elevated latency under burst traffic. The constant lives in `autocomplete/config.ts`; any change requires a load test against the staging index, since shorter intervals roughly double query volume. When reviewing pull requests that touch this value, confirm a benchmark report is attached and that the fallback cache behavior is unchanged. Questions about the benchmark process can be sent to the widget maintainers at the address below.

escalation mailbox, yafog-kafof: eliok@xolmarcloud.local